<b>Stay always online and prevent data loss</b><br>As soon as the power fails, an APC Smart-UPS immediately supplies emergency power to all connected equipment. Because an APC UPS does this automatically, you prevent unwanted failure of, for example, a PC, server or switch. With the APC PowerChute Network shutdown software, you can even have critical IT hardware shut down automatically and in a controlled manner when the UPS battery is almost empty. This prevents data loss, downtime and physical damage to hardware.<br><br><b>Extend the runtime</b><br>You can easily increase the number of minutes that the APC SMX UPS can independently supply emergency power by connecting external battery packs (SMX120RMBP2U). A runtime of several hours is even possible.<br><br><b>Safety</b><br>In addition, a Smart-UPS protects connected devices against peak voltage caused by lightning, among other things. Both are extended by 3 years to 6 and 5 years respectively with the APC service pack (WBEXTWAR3YR-SP-05).<br><br><b>Switched Outlet Groups: Remote reboot and phased start-up</b><br>Thanks to the Switched Outlet Groups, it is possible to configure a phased/delayed power-on per UPS outlet group. This reduces the peak load on the UPS and brings it closer to the constant load, which can limit oversizing of the UPS.<br><br>It is also possible to reset a group of multiple UPS outlets and the equipment connected to them.
